Bedouin Development Authority Holds Meeting on "Settlement Path" Program in Mar'it

Alarab
Translated & summarized from Alarab by baba
The story · English

The Bedouin Development and Settlement Authority in the Negev held a meeting on Monday, September 7, 2026, in the Bedouin town of Mar'it, as part of its "Settlement Path" program. The meeting was attended by the Authority's Director-General Yuval Turgeman, Authority management, professionals, and representatives of families with land ownership claims in Mar'it.

The program's professional team presented the benefits and compensation offered by the "Settlement Path" initiative and answered participants' questions. While residents sought direct information, some attendees expressed reservations and distrust towards the Authority. Tensions were also noted among different families.

The Authority stated that these meetings are part of a series aimed at fostering direct dialogue, removing obstacles, and providing comprehensive information to residents. The "Settlement Path" program is currently in the application phase, with a deadline of the end of November 2026 to apply for participation. Successful applicants can then move to negotiations to reach a settlement agreement and regulate land ownership claims.

Director-General Turgeman emphasized the importance of direct engagement, stating, "We consider direct engagement with residents a fundamental part of this process. It is important for us to reach the towns, sit face-to-face with the families, listen to questions, concerns, and objections, and present the program as it is." He added that the Authority will continue to provide information to families wishing to make informed decisions.

The Authority reiterated that the meetings aim to facilitate direct discussion, address concerns, and provide accurate information to residents.
